初级Java程序员常见错误:类型转换失败案例
在初级Java程序员的编程过程中,经常会遇到类型转换失败的问题。这里提供一个常见的案例:
原始数据类型:
假设有一个整数类型的变量intNum = 5;
目标数据类型:
然后你想要将这个整数转换为字符串类型String strNum = intNum + "";
问题所在:
这时候你会遇到类型转换失败的问题,因为intNum
是一个整型,直接拼接在strNum
上是不行的。解决方法:
通常会使用Java提供的内置函数来完成类型转换。如上述案例,可以将intNum + "";
改写为:String strNum = Integer.toString(intNum); // 使用Integer.toString()进行转换
这样就可以避免类型转换失败的问题了。
还没有评论,来说两句吧...